Travel documents
Don’t forget your passport, Visa Letter, travel insurance, air tickets, address and phone number for the Exeter College Summer Programme! We strongly recommend that you make copies of these documents and keep them separately from the originals.

As part of your immigration clearance to enter the UK you may be asked for additional supporting documents. Please visit our ‘Insurance and Visa Information’ page for more information. If you have an official photo ID, we recommend you bring this with you to use in the UK in place of your passport, which can be kept securely at Cohen Quadrangle.

Electrical Equipment and laptops
If you have a laptop we recommend you bring it with you. You will have Wi-Fi access throughout the College sites at the Cohen Quadrangle and Turl Street. Using internet communication interfaces such as FaceTime is a good and free way to keep in touch with family and friends at home. The College allows reasonable internet bandwidth usage, but restrictions will be imposed if we notice high usage outside the realms of what is deemed acceptable.

All electric and electronic devices including laptops should comply with UK health and safety regulations. Portable Appliance Testing (PAT) will be conducted early in the programme and devices which do not comply with these regulations will be removed and may only be returned at the end of the programme.

Clothes
UK weather is well known to be unpredictable! We hope for summer sunshine, but we recommend you bring something to keep warm and dry. One essential is a comfortable pair of shoes for sightseeing in Oxford and other UK cities.

Although there isn’t a ‘dress code’ for Formal Dinners, the expectation is that you will be smart and these are occasions for dressing up! Traditionally, cocktail dresses, suits and ties are worn.
